drm/tegra: Changes for v4.17-rc1

This fixes mmap() for fbdev devices by providing a custom implementation
based on the KMS variant. This is a fairly exotic case these days, hence
why it is not flagged for stable.

There is also support for dedicating one of the overlay planes to serve
as a hardware cursor on older Tegra that did support hardware cursors
but not RGBA formats for it.

Planes will now also export the IN_FORMATS property by supporting the
various block-linear tiling modifiers for RGBA pixel formats.

Other than that, there's a bit of cleanup of DMA API abuse, use of the
private object infrastructure for global state (rather than subclassing
atomic state objects) and an implementation of -&gt;{begin,end}_cpu_access
callbacks for PRIME exported buffers, which allow users to perform cache
maintenance on these buffers.

Commit ebae8d07435a ("drm/tegra: dc: Implement legacy blending") broke
support for YUV overlays by accident. The reason is that YUV formats are
considered opaque because they have no alpha component, but on the other
hand no corresponding format with an alpha component can be returned. In
the case of YUV formats, the opaque format is the same as the alpha
format, so add the special case to restore YUV overlay support.

This implements alpha blending on legacy display controllers (Tegra20,
Tegra30 and Tegra114). While it's theoretically possible to support the
zpos property to enable userspace to specify the Z-order of each plane
individually, this is not currently supported and the same fixed Z-
order as previously defined is used.

Reverts commit 71835caa00e8 ("drm/tegra: fb: Force alpha formats") since
the opaque formats are now supported.
